Subject: Key rotation — BranchBroom bot

Hey, quick heads-up: we rotated credentials for BranchBroom, the bot that prunes stale branches on Forgeyard. The old key dies at midnight, so update the on-call secrets bundle before then. Nothing else changes—same scopes, same schedule. The new key for the Forgeyard internal API is below.

app token of tajog-bawef = kto4_5C4l

Q2 Planning Note — Sales Leads

Second-source search for the Corvette valve assembly is narrowing. Three candidates remain: Brantwick Tooling, Osper Fabrication, and Nivell Works. Audits complete on two. Target: qualified alternate by end of quarter to de-risk Halloway orders. Do not discuss externally until contracts close. The direction we intend to take is noted below.

internal memo for kawip-hadug: Headcount on the Wenwyn team goes from 7 to 140 by the end of January. Gross margin on Wenwyn came in at 20 percent against a plan of 15 percent.

Before cutting the release, verify that the new command-stack format is enabled. Strandline 9 replaces snapshot-based undo with granular command journaling; old per-diagram snapshots are read once, converted, then discarded. Confirm the converter ran on every tenant workspace — partial migration leaves redo unavailable after the first undo, which users report as data loss. Do not proceed until conversion counters match workspace counts. The converter reads its behavior from the configuration below.

deployment values, bahof-badug:
[rusix]
team = zorok
access_code = ac_641cbe
owner = ulair.tamius
host = rusix.torvasoft.local
port = 5672
peer = ulaix.sivrelworks.internal
salt = 1df570ed
pin = 6327

## Deployment: Partner SFTP Drop

Greywharf Logistics picks up nightly extract files from our SFTP drop. The release job for Cartfall must publish files before 02:00 so the partner's sweep catches them. Releases that change the extract schema require a one-cycle overlap where both formats are written. Confirm the drop directory is writable after each deploy. The uploader reads its configuration from the block below:

deployment values, yadug-bawif:
[framir]
team = pelox
access_code = ac_a38ab2
owner = tamion.julael
host = framir.tolvaqlabs.test
port = 11211
peer = tammir.zemvargrid.local
salt = 2215ef03
pin = 1541